While Boylan Catholic didn't have the best season last year (they finished 6-27), it's starting to look like those struggles are a thing of the past. It was close, but on Fridaythey capped 2025 with a 50-47 victory over the Jacobs Golden Eagles. The 50-point effort marked the Titans' lowest-scoring contest of the season, but in the end it didn't matter.
Jacobs' loss shouldn't obscure the performances of Elijah Bell, who posted 21 points in addition to eight boards and three steals, and Jack Magee, who went 5-for-12 en route to 15 points. Another player making a difference was Samson Averehi, who had five points along with five assists and five rebounds.
Boylan Catholic's win bumped their record up to 8-6. As for Jacobs, they have been struggling recently as they've lost three of their last four games. That's put a noticeable dent in their 8-5 record this season.
Boylan Catholic has already played their next matchup, a 74-68 victory against North Chicago on the 3rd. As for Jacobs, they will get a bit of extra time to process the defeat as their next game is a ways off. They'll take on McHenry at 7:00 p.m. on January 7th. The Golden Eagles will need to watch out since the Warriors have now posted at least 55 points in their last three contests.
